Ramp

Backend Engineer – Financial Systems

Ramp

full-time

Posted on:

Location Type: Hybrid

Location: New York City • New York • 🇺🇸 United States

Visit company website
AI Apply
Apply

Salary

💰 $180,000 - $259,000 per year

Job Level

Mid-LevelSenior

Tech Stack

Distributed SystemsPythonSQL

About the role

  • Design and build large-scale financial systems that handle high volumes of transactional data with correctness and precision
  • Create robust and extensible data models and orchestration logic for ledgering, reconciliation, and financial reporting systems
  • Partner directly with our CFO and finance leadership to translate business requirements into technical specifications
  • Build systems that maintain auditability, data integrity, and regulatory compliance across our expanding product ecosystem
  • Work on complex problems involving distributed systems, event-driven architectures, and financial data at scale
  • Collaborate with engineers who care deeply about correctness, reliability, and elegant system design

Requirements

  • 3-5 years of backend engineering experience with expertise in building data-intensive systems
  • Strong Python experience (ideally as your primary language)
  • Deep SQL knowledge and experience working with complex data models
  • Proven system design skills - you can take high-level requirements and architect scalable, maintainable solutions
  • Experience thriving in startup-like environments with high ambiguity and requiring independent problem-solving
  • Comfortable working flexibly across the stack - equally at home prototyping analyses in a Jupyter notebook and implementing production backend endpoints
  • Track record of building reliable, well-tested systems where correctness matters
Benefits
  • 100% medical, dental & vision insurance coverage for you
  • Partially covered for your dependents
  • One Medical annual membership
  • 401k (including employer match on contributions made while employed by Ramp)
  • Flexible PTO
  • Fertility HRA (up to $5,000 per year)
  • WFH stipend to support your home office needs
  • Wellness stipend
  • Parental Leave
  • Relocation support to NYC or SF (as needed)
  • Pet insurance

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
PythonSQLdata modelssystem designbackend engineeringdata-intensive systemsevent-driven architecturesdistributed systemsledgeringfinancial reporting
Soft skills
problem-solvingcollaborationindependent workadaptabilityattention to detailcommunicationreliabilityelegant system designbusiness requirements translationworking in ambiguity
Thomson Reuters

Senior Software Engineer, Backend

Thomson Reuters
Seniorfull-time$126k–$234k / yearMinnesota, Missouri, New York, Texas · 🇺🇸 United States
Posted: 5 hours agoSource: thomsonreuters.wd5.myworkdayjobs.com
AWSPostgresPython
Ro

Senior Software Engineer, Backend – Patient Experience

Ro
Seniorfull-time$182k–$220k / yearNew York · 🇺🇸 United States
Posted: 23 hours agoSource: jobs.lever.co
Distributed SystemsDjangoPython
Stellar Development Foundation

Senior Software Engineer, C++

Stellar Development Foundation
Seniorfull-time$180k–$290k / yearNew York · 🇺🇸 United States
Posted: 2 days agoSource: jobs.ashbyhq.com
Rust
Stellar Development Foundation

Senior Software Engineer, Rust

Stellar Development Foundation
Seniorfull-time$170k–$260k / yearNew York · 🇺🇸 United States
Posted: 2 days agoSource: jobs.ashbyhq.com
GoJavaScriptNode.jsPythonRust
Radar

Product Engineer, Backend

Radar
Mid · Seniorfull-time$200k–$300k / yearNew York · 🇺🇸 United States
Posted: 2 days agoSource: jobs.ashbyhq.com
PythonRustScalaTypeScript